Hi, I'm new too all this. I have searched but cant find anything. How would I go about installing these clip ons I got on ebay? http://www.ebay.com/itm/151718732245?_trksid=p2057872.m2749.l2649&ssPageName=STRK%3AMEBIDX%3AIT

also is this where the air goes into the forks? can I remove the top triple tree off with the bike still standing and slip on the clip ons or do i have to lift up the front and hammer down the forks? whats the best and easiest way. Thank you!

Remove the top fork cap with the valve in it. Loosen the trip tree bolts holding the forks in. Twist said fork down until it clears the upper tree enough to slide your clip on onto the fork and reverse the steps from there. You''ll need to raise the front of the bike off the ground and support it.
Yes , that's where the air goes.
